在IntelliJ IDEA中配置JavaFX 11

作者:蛮不讲李2024.04.15 03:40浏览量:37

简介:本文将指导您如何在IntelliJ IDEA中配置JavaFX 11,包括设置SDK、创建JavaFX项目、添加库和运行JavaFX应用程序。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

在IntelliJ IDEA中配置JavaFX 11

一、背景介绍

JavaFX是一个用于构建富客户端应用程序的开源框架。随着JavaFX 11的发布,Oracle对其许可策略进行了更改,使其成为开源项目。为了在IntelliJ IDEA中成功配置JavaFX 11,您需要遵循一系列步骤来设置SDK、创建项目、添加库和运行应用程序。

二、设置JavaFX 11 SDK

  1. 下载JavaFX 11 SDK:首先,您需要从OpenJFX官方网站下载JavaFX 11 SDK。

  2. 配置SDK:在IntelliJ IDEA中,转到“File” > “Project Structure” > “SDKs”。点击“+”按钮,选择“JDK”,然后定位到您下载的JavaFX 11 SDK文件夹。

三、创建JavaFX 11项目

  1. 新建项目:在IntelliJ IDEA中,选择“Create New Project”。

  2. 选择项目类型:在左侧的面板中,选择“Java”。在右侧,选择“JavaFX”作为项目模板。

  3. 配置项目设置:为项目命名并选择JavaFX SDK版本。

四、添加JavaFX库

  1. 手动添加库:在您的项目中,右键点击“Libraries”文件夹,选择“Add Library” > “From Maven”。在搜索栏中输入JavaFX库的坐标,如org.openjfx:javafx-controls:11,然后点击“OK”。

  2. 配置模块:在“Project Structure” > “Modules”中,确保JavaFX库已添加到您的模块依赖中。

五、运行JavaFX应用程序

  1. 配置运行配置:在“Run” > “Edit Configurations”中,确保“VM options”中包含--module-path--add-modules参数,指向您的JavaFX库。

  2. 运行应用程序:点击运行按钮或使用快捷键运行您的JavaFX应用程序。

六、注意事项

  • 确保您的IntelliJ IDEA版本支持JavaFX 11。
  • 在某些情况下,您可能需要手动配置JavaFX模块路径和其他参数。
  • 如果您遇到任何问题,请查看IntelliJ IDEA和JavaFX的官方文档或社区论坛以获取帮助。

七、总结

通过以上步骤,您应该能够在IntelliJ IDEA中成功配置JavaFX 11。配置JavaFX项目可能需要一些耐心和细心,但一旦完成,您将能够利用JavaFX的强大功能构建出色的富客户端应用程序。记住,不断学习和实践是提高您技能的关键。

八、参考资料

article bottom image

相关文章推荐

发表评论